according to my book the projectile is cranking out at 1785fps from the muzzle. At 100 yards, your still moving at 1505 and have 1257 in energy which is plenty. At 150 yards you've slowed down to 1382 and the energy has dropped to 1062 which is well above the number of 600 - 800. At 200 yards your zooming along at 1277 and the energy is still at 905. Finally at 250 yards you have reached 1185 in speed but are still at 780 for energy. With the right shot placement there is no reason why that load would not kill a Whitetail all the way out to 250 yards. I'm sorry the charts do not seem to post well, but I will do my best..
